Definition of Social Clubs and Associations
Social clubs are organizations that are formed by individuals with common interests, hobbies, or activities. The main objective of social clubs is to bring people together to build a community that shares similar interests. Associations, on the other hand, are groups that are formed to address a specific cause or situation. They also seek to bring people with similar interests together but focus more on advocating for a particular cause or issue.
Types of Social Clubs Available
There are various types of social clubs available in the United Kingdom, ranging from sports clubs to hobby-based clubs. Some of the most popular social clubs include golf clubs, book clubs, cycling clubs, theatre clubs, wine clubs, and fitness clubs. Additionally, there are also exclusive member-only social clubs that cater to high-net-worth individuals, such as The Arts Club in London.
Benefits of Joining a Social Club
Joining a social club comes with various benefits. Firstly, social clubs provide an opportunity to meet new people with similar interests, making it easier to build lasting friendships. Secondly, social clubs offer a platform for members to learn new skills or develop existing ones. Additionally, social clubs provide a sense of community and belonging, which can contribute positively to mental health and wellbeing. Lastly, membership in some social clubs comes with perks such as discounted rates for activities and events.
Membership Requirements
Membership requirements may differ for each social club, but some general requirements include payment of membership fees, completion of membership application forms, and adherence to the club's rules and regulations. Some clubs may require new members to be introduced by existing members or undergo a probationary period. Additionally, some social clubs have a strict membership selection process that involves interviews and background checks, especially for exclusive member-only clubs.
Activities Offered by Social Clubs
Social clubs offer various activities, events, and programs for their members. Activities may include sports, culinary, cultural, or educational programs. For sports clubs, activities may include training sessions, tournaments, or friendly games with other sports clubs. For hobby-based clubs such as book clubs, activities may include book readings, authors' talks, or literary festivals. Additionally, social clubs may also organize trips, tours, and other group activities to promote social interaction among members.
Social Club Etiquette
Each social club may have its own specific etiquette that members must observe. However, some general social club etiquettes include following the club's rules and regulations, treating other members with respect, being punctual and reliable, and contributing positively to the club's activities and events. Additionally, members should also communicate openly and honestly with the club's leadership and other members, especially if they have concerns or suggestions that can help improve the club's operations.
Comparison of Social Clubs and Associations
While social clubs and associations share some similarities, such as bringing people with similar interests together, they differ in their primary objectives. Social clubs focus more on creating a community that enjoys social interaction and shared interests, while associations focus on advocating for a specific cause or issue. Additionally, social clubs may offer a wider range of activities and programs, while associations may concentrate more on education, awareness, and activism relating to their cause.
Conclusion and Final Thoughts on Social Clubs
Social clubs are excellent platforms for building new relationships, learning new skills, and enjoying social interaction with like-minded individuals. With various types of social clubs available, there is something for everyone. Joining a social club can be a significant investment in oneself, and the benefits can be rewarding, including improved mental health and wellbeing, personal growth, and new opportunities to explore exciting hobbies and interests.
